Why Live in San Clemente

In San Clemente, desert mesquite, palm trees and various cacti line the streets, decorating the roundabouts and adding flair to front yards. The residential neighborhood is about 6 miles southeast of downtown Tucson and has access to retail and ...

Frequently Asked Questions

Is San Clemente a good place to live?
San Clemente is a good place to live. San Clemente is considered somewhat walkable and very bikeable with some transit options. San Clemente is a neighborhood with a crime score of 4, on par with the average neighborhood in the U.S. San Clemente has 1 park for recreational activities. It has a median age of 43. The average household income is $117,768 which is above the national average. College graduates make up 59.2% of residents. A majority of residents in San Clemente are home owners, with 32.9% of residents renting and 67.1% of residents owning their home. Is San Clemente, AZ a safe neighborhood?
San Clemente, AZ is a safe neighborhood and is on par with the average neighborhood in the United States. It received a crime score of 4 out of 10.
How much do you need to make to afford a house in San Clemente?
The median home price in San Clemente is $375,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$75,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.26%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$1,850 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$79K a year to afford the median home price in San Clemente. The average household income in San Clemente is $118K.
